Ventilation Fan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Ventilation fan repair services focus on restoring proper airflow and ventilation within residential properties. These services typically cover a range of projects, including fixing exhaust fans in bathrooms and kitchens, repairing attic ventilation fans, and addressing issues with whole-house ventilation systems. Homeowners often seek assistance when their fans are noisy, not operating at all, or failing to effectively remove moisture, odors, or airborne contaminants, which can impact indoor air quality and comfort.
Before requesting ventilation fan repairs, property owners usually want to understand the cause of the problem, the scope of work needed, and any potential disruptions during the repair process. Clarifying whether the issue involves electrical components, mechanical parts, or ductwork can help determine the best course of action. Additionally, understanding the age and condition of existing fans can assist in planning for repairs or possible replacements to ensure optimal ventilation performance.

Ventilation Fan Repair Questions
How do I know if my ventilation fan needs repair? Signs include unusual noises, reduced airflow, or persistent odors indicating the fan isn't functioning properly.
What are common issues that require ventilation fan repair? Common problems include motor failures, broken blades, or electrical wiring issues affecting performance.
Can a ventilation fan be repaired or does it need replacement? Many issues can be fixed through repairs, but severe damage or age may require a new fan installation.
